Im guessing its a 3.7 Ratio.

3.0 Plod Manual with calibrated speedo in 5th gear -

3.7 LSD Diff at 70mph = 2550 rpm
3.9 LSD Diff at 70mph = 3000 rpm

And yes, getting very rare now, good working LSD for the Migs now are like Hens Teeth.  :y
